Hyperledger Composer 的部署过程
Hyperledger Composer's deployment process
Composer 的模型由 javascript 代码、实体、查询定义和访问规则组成。据我了解,部署后一切都变成了某种可执行代码,因为 Fabric 没有类似的东西。
部署过程中到底发生了什么?所有东西都被编译成某种字节码了吗?例如,Composer 的事务函数正以某种方式成为 Fabric 的 Invoke 方法的一部分,但究竟如何映射到另一个呢?
我问是因为我想向 Composer 添加一项功能以 运行 基于 js 的查询,并且它们需要以某种方式映射到 Fabric 的查询方法。
你需要研究一下Hyperledger Composer的架构。
您正在寻找的是与底层 Fabric 交互的 composer-runtime。
查看这些幻灯片:
link
Composer 的模型由 javascript 代码、实体、查询定义和访问规则组成。据我了解,部署后一切都变成了某种可执行代码,因为 Fabric 没有类似的东西。
部署过程中到底发生了什么?所有东西都被编译成某种字节码了吗?例如,Composer 的事务函数正以某种方式成为 Fabric 的 Invoke 方法的一部分,但究竟如何映射到另一个呢?
我问是因为我想向 Composer 添加一项功能以 运行 基于 js 的查询,并且它们需要以某种方式映射到 Fabric 的查询方法。
你需要研究一下Hyperledger Composer的架构。
您正在寻找的是与底层 Fabric 交互的 composer-runtime。 查看这些幻灯片: link